Explain why antibiotics are ineffective against viruses.

Antibiotics are ineffective against viruses because viruses are not composed of cells. Antibiotics break down a bacteria's cell walls or stopping the bacteria's ability to repair its DNA. This is why it was advised not to take antibiotics for viral infections. It may lead to antibiotic resistance in the future.
